Shenzhen Hepalink Pharmaceutical: The Engine of Wealth
At the heart of Li Tan's immense fortune lies Shenzhen Hepalink Pharmaceutical, a company that has carved out a critical niche in the global healthcare market. Hepalink is renowned for being a leading producer of Heparin Sodium API (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ient) and related drugs. Heparin is an indispensable anticoagulant, or blood thinner, used extensively in medical procedures ranging from surgery and dialysis to the treatment of deep vein thrombosis and pulmonary embolism. Its importance in preventing life-threatening blood clots makes it a cornerstone drug in hospitals and clinics worldwide.

A Family Enterprise: The Li-Tan Shareholding Dynamic
The story of Shenzhen Hepalink Pharmaceutical is also one of family leadership and concentrated ownership. While Li Tan holds a substantial 32% stake in the company, playing a crucial role as director and vice president, her husband, Li Li, serves as the chairman and is the single largest individual shareholder with an even larger 40%. This collective family control highlights a common model in many successful Chinese enterprises, where shared vision and complementary leadership roles drive business growth.
The significant percentage of shares held by Li Tan directly correlates with her reported net worth. As a company grows in value, so too does the wealth of its owners.
